如何将比特币数据导入通达信
比特币数据可通过本地文件手动导入、API脚本自动同步两种主流方案完整接入通达信,普通币圈用户优先采用CSV文件手动导入历史K线,有编程基础的交易者可借助交易所API搭配Python脚本实现行情自动更新,两种方式均可在通达信内生成标准K线图表,复用软件自带均线、MACD、布林带等全量技术指标进行比特币行情复盘分析。

正式导入前首要完成数据源采集与数据规整预处理工作,通达信原生不兼容数字货币原始数据格式,仅识别以YYYYMMDD为标准日期、字段按代码、开盘、最高、最低、收盘、成交量排序的TXT或CSV文本文件,用户可从境外行情站点、头部交易所行情板块下载BTC/USDT日线、小时线原始行情数据,下载后的原始数据普遍存在日期混杂时分秒、字段顺序错乱、空值乱码等问题,需要借助Excel批量整理,自定义6位数字虚拟代码作为比特币专属证券编码,剔除无效空行与异常价格数据,另存为逗号分隔的CSV文档,新手尽量拆分周期保存文件,日线、短周期分时数据分开归档,避免单文件数据体量过大导致通达信导入卡顿、丢数据的情况。

整理完数据后进入通达信软件执行本地文件导入操作,打开通达信顶部菜单栏的系统选项,下拉找到数据维护工具,在弹窗内选定“导入历史行情数据”分类,在文件路径中选中预处理完毕的比特币CSV文档,下一步设置分隔符为逗号,逐一匹配文档字段与通达信内置数据栏目,重点核对日期与价格字段映射关系,字段错位会直接出现K线变形、价格归零问题,确认参数后点击开始导入,数万条日线数据通常数十秒即可完成,导入结束后新建自定义板块命名BTC,把自定义编码添加至板块,打开K线界面就能调取比特币历史走势,导入后随机截取十余个交易日数据交叉比对原始数据源,排查漏导、错导问题,保证后续技术分析的数据基准无误。

想要实现比特币实时行情自动更新则需要API自动化导入方案,用户在对应交易所官网申请开放API访问密钥,利用Python结合开源数据处理库调取接口实时抓取价格数据,脚本内置格式转换逻辑,自动把抓取的实时数据转化为通达信适配文件并定时覆写,搭配MOOTDX开源通达信数据对接工具,简化本地数据库写入流程,设置定时任务后软件可自动刷新每日行情,该方案适合长期盯盘、做量化回测的资深币圈用户,使用中注意妥善保管API密钥,避免密钥外泄引发资产相关风险,同时设置脚本异常预警,防止交易所接口限流、断连造成行情中断漏更。
数据导入完成后还有细节优化与使用补充事项,比特币无A股涨跌停限制,通达信默认涨跌幅计算公式适配股票规则,用户打开公式管理器微调涨跌幅计算源码,贴合加密货币无涨跌幅的市场规则,也能自行编写适配比特币波动特性的副图指标,针对合约与现货不同交易标的,可建立多个自定义代码区分BTC现货与BTC合约数据,分开存放在不同板块,后续复盘时快速切换对比走势,此外通达信无法原生获取链上转账、持仓筹码等链上数据,这类另类数据无法通过常规导入方式接入,仅能依靠行情K线数据开展盘面技术研判。